Meditation may be the most important practice for calming the mind. A relaxed thoughts can lead to a healthful, happy and prosperous everyday life. It may possibly cure illnesses and speed up healing processes. We explain the basic procedure under referred to as prana-dharana. Prana in Sanskrit stands for that air that we breathe. It’s one of the most common act of life which begins from birth and goes on till death. But generally, we are not aware of the breath until our interest is drawn close to it. Dharana implies its awareness. Prana-dharana signifies applying the mind on the flow of air once we breathe. The technique is as explained under:

Sit within a posture acceptable for meditation. The prevalent postures are Siddhasana, Padmasana and Swastikasana. But when you cannot do that, just sit cross-legged. Your back ought to be directly and eyes closed. Your knees should be placed nicely around the floor. Tend not to stoop your shoulders back again. The entire entire body ought to be relaxed plus the total frame continual not having exerting any pull or stress around the thighs, feet, knees, backbone or neck. There will need to be no stretch on pressure along the stomach wall. Let the abdominal wall sway gently backwards and forwards quite smoothly and easily with each respiration. Facial muscle tissues will need to be calm and mouth closed with a small gap involving the two jaws these the upper and lower teeth usually do not exert strain on each other. Your tongue will need to touch the palate with tip touching the again of your upper front teeth. Guarantee the lips, tongue or even the reduce jaws usually do not transfer. Your eyeballs and eyelids need to be regular and also the muscle groups of your forehead peaceful.

Your complete posture really should be secure, steady and peaceful. You’ll want to not think strain on any part of the entire body. Now commence building the awareness of breathing. The flow of air must be uniform, sluggish and smooth. Do not make any energy or exercise any control. Never hold breath. Really don’t utter any word or see any image. This will relaxed your mind and assist you to accomplish peace.
